AI Contract Overview
The contract involves the replacement and integration of a robotic arm into an existing automated high throughput imaging platform within a laboratory setting. The scope covers the full process including mechanical installation, system calibration, and operational testing to ensure the robotic arm functions seamlessly as part of the imaging platform's workflow. This work is designated as a subcontract opportunity with an emphasis on hardware integration and robotics within the industrial machinery sector. Issued by the Department of the Interior's Ibc Acq Svcs Directorate, the project requires adherence to specific installation and testing procedures to meet performance standards. The contract aligns with the NAICS code 333318, which relates to the manufacturing and integration of commercial and industrial machinery. Proposals must be submitted by the deadline of May 21, 2026, and the contract activities will be executed in a laboratory environment, although the exact location details are not specified. This opportunity focuses on enhancing the capabilities of automated imaging through precision hardware upgrades and thorough system validation.
